Urdaneta City is a plastic free city. Please know where to put your plastic garbage and, if possible, don’t use any plastics. Urdaneta city is the gateway of the north. It is one of the most progressive and the cleanest, greenest and livable cities in region 1. There is a famous landmark in our city which is the big carabao statue.
Urdaneta City is a great place. It is one of the cleanest city in Pangasinan and the people here are very kind and helpful. If you will reside in Urdaneta, you will not be having difficulties in buying things for your house because there are plenty of convenience store here and three shopping malls.
Urdaneta City, Pangasinan, is one of the most livable cities north of Manila. The city offers reputable public and private schools and colleges and convenient expressways. Its market sells cheap fruits, vegetables, fish and meat. It is also the gateway to the cooler Baguio mountains, famous churches of Manaoag and the beaches of La Union.
